According to Milutin Milanković, which of the following are a contributing factor to ice-age cycles? Choose one: A. increased am

ounts of volcanic ash B. variations in the shape of the Earth's orbit C. variations in ocean temperature D. sunspot cycles

Answer:

B. variations in the shape of the Earth's orbit

Explanation:

Ice age cycles according to Milutin Milanković who was a Serbian geophysicist and climatologist can be defined as the glacial and interglacial cycles or periods which occurs due to the unsteady movement of the Earth in its orbit. This unsteady movement resulted in a change in way solar energy was been distributed on the surface of the Earth.

The ice age cycles are referred

to as Milutin Milanković cycles. The ice age cycles according to Milutin Milanković has two cycles, the shorter cycle is for an average of 100,000 years while the longer cycle is for an average of 413,000 years.

These ice age cycles are important because they have an effect on the Earth's climate. Such effects include

a. The way ice is been formed on the earth.

b. The distribution of solar energy from the sun or the amount of sunlight exposure to the regions on the earth.

One of the factors contributing to the ice age cycles is the variations in the

shape of the Earth's orbit.

51. What is the importance of the photic zone in aquatic habitats? a. Oxygen levels are very low in the photic zone, often resul
marshall27 [118]

Answer: e. The photic zone is where most primary production occurs.

Explanation:

The photic zone can be define as the sunlight or photosynthetic zone. It is the uppermost layer of the water body like lake, ocean, pond or others. This zone receives the maximum sunlight in the entire water body. Thus this facilitates the growth of large number of plants and other autotrophs like diatoms. This is called as the zone of primary productivity because in water the sunlight and dissolved atmospheric carbon dioxide are available for conducting the process of photosynthesis.
